Herein, how are diving boards made?

To make the diving board's shell, workers load a sheet of acrylic into a clamping machine, which transports it into an oven. The oven heats the sheet for about 30 seconds to soften it, then a forming machine applies suction to draw the softened acrylic tightly over a mold in the shape of two diving boards.

What are the heights of the Olympic diving boards?

There are two heights for Olympic diving boards: 3 meters and 10 meters. The 3-meter diving board is a springboard, and the 10-meter diving board is a platform. The springboard is adjustable for more or less spring, at least 4.8 meters long and a half-meter wide and equipped with a non-slip surface.

How does a diving board work?

Almost all of a diver'swork” is done on the diving board – by putting energy into the board, a diver harness the “equal and opposite” Newton's Third Law of Motion, with that energy eventually being transferred back into projecting the diver up and forward away from the diving board.

How much do diving boards cost?

The cost of a diving board itself is usually in the range of $300-600, though you can also find high-end aluminum boards for over $1000. This doesn't include the cost of installation, which should be done by a professional.

Does a diving board increase insurance?

Diving boards also eliminate the amount of pool space you have. Depending on your insurance policy, your insurance is most likely to go up because of a diving board. This is because it's considered a high insurance risk to companies, even the manufacturers.

What is the highest diving board in the world?

The highest dive from a diving board is 58.8 m (192 ft 10 in) and was achieved by Lazaro "Laso" Schaller (Switzerland/Brazil) in Maggia, Ticino, Switzerland, on 4 August, 2015.

How tall is an Olympic high dive?

In the world championships, men jump from a 27-metre-high (89 ft) platform while women jump from a 20-metre-high (66 ft) platform. In other official competitions, men generally dive from a height of 22–27 metres (72–89 ft) while women dive from a height of 18–23 metres (59–75 ft).

When was springboard diving invented?

Dr G.E. Sheldon of the United States became the first Olympic diving champion. Springboard diving for men was introduced at the 1908 Olympic Games in London. Platform diving for women followed in 1912 at the Stockholm Olympic Games and women's springboard was added in 1920 at the Games in Antwerp.

What is a hurdle in diving?

The hurdle is where a diver gets height from the board and is able to execute a dive successfully. It is a fundamental skill that all divers will consistently work on throughout their diving careers.
